Создание файловых систем


Создав участки и разделы, вы уже практически подготовили диск к использованию. Все, что остается сделать, — это создать файловые системы. Создать новую файловую систему UFS можно с помощью утилиты newfs(8). Используйте ключ -U, чтобы разрешить применение механизма Soft Updates. О некоторых других параметрах newfs(8) мы поговорим в оставшейся части этой главы, а пока просто создадим стандартную файловую систему UFS2:

# newfs -U /dev/da2s1d
/dev/da2s1d: 2048.0MB (4194304 sectors) block size 16384, fragment size 2048
        using 12 cylinder groups of 183.77MB, 11761 blks, 23552 inodes.
        with soft updates
super-block backups (for fsck -b #) at:
 160, 376512, 752864, 1129216, 1505568, 1881920, 2258272, 2634624, 3010976,
 3387328, 3763680, 4140032

В самом начале newfs(8) сообщает основные сведения о новой файловой системе, такие как ее размер, количество секторов и блоков, а также размеры блоков и фрагментов. Далее следует количество индексных дескрипторов (inodes). В ходе работы утилита newfs(8) выводит информацию о местоположении каждого суперблока — только затем, чтобы вы видели: что-то происходит. (Это было очень важно в эпоху медлительных компьютеров — процесс создания большой файловой системы мог длиться несколько минут, и утилита тактично намекала, что она не зависла и продолжает работать.)

Вы можете указать размеры блоков и фрагментов с помощью ключей -b и -f, соответственно. Если эти параметры не указаны в командной строке, newfs(8) проверит содержимое метки диска и возьмет эту информацию оттуда. Если эти значения не были указаны при создании метки диска, будут использованы значения по умолчанию. Лично я предпочитаю указывать эти значения в метке диска просто потому, что это дает отличную возможность дважды проверить себя. В любом случае newfs(8) обновит информацию о размерах блоков и фрагментов для последующего использования.

Теперь, когда вы научились создавать участки и разделы, а также форматировать диски, перейдем к рассмотрению более сложных тем, связанных с управлением дисками. Одна из таких тем — RAID.

Комментарии запрещены.